Product Description:
This sports documentary explores the ins and outs of what makes someone greater than the rest. It examines the psychology of people who achieve more than the average person and applies that knowledge to famous athletes, not only giving an analysis of them, but personal interviews and insights from players themselves. Written and Directed by Gabe Polsky.
